A rare Chinese gilt bronze figure of Vajrasattva 15th century

十五世紀 銅鎏金金剛勇識菩薩坐像

£10,000 - £20,000

A rare Chinese gilt bronze figure of Vajrasattva 15th century, seated in a lotus position, wearing an elaborate headdress upon a high chignon and adorned with jewellery and ribbons, holding a silver vajra in one hand and a bell in the other, raised on a high double lotus base, 13.6cm.

Cf. The Complete Collection of Treasures in The Palace Museum, Buddhist Statues of Tibet, p.175 for a similar figure in gilt copper also dated to the 15th century.
